TEAM NEWS: Derby County vs West Bromwich Albion

John Eustace has confirmed his Derby County team to face West Bromwich Albion at Pride Park Stadium in the Sky Bet Championship on Friday night.


The Rams team has seen five changes from their mid-week 2-1 victory at The Valley against Charlton Athletic.

Goalkeeper Jacob Widell Zetterström will be between the sticks after missing the action on Tuesday due to illness, with Richard O'Donnell taking his place.

Lewis Travis will captain the Rams after coming from the bench on Tuesday night, while Danny Batth will take his place in the heart of defence alongside Sondre Langås.


Left-sider Callum Elder will make his 24th Championship outing of the season, while Joe Ward will operate on the opposite flank.

Tuesday night’s goalscorer, Bobby Clark, will play his 31st match for the Rams. Rhian Brewster also starts in attack at Pride Park.


Derby County: Zetterström (GK), Batth, Langås, Agyemang, Brewster, Ozoh, Elder, Ward, Brereton Díaz, Travis (C), Clark.

Substitutes: O’Donnell (GK), Forsyth, Blackett-Taylor, Weimann, Salvesen, Thompson, Jackson, Sanderson, Fraulo.
